  • Patent number: 9730991
    Abstract: A live attenuated Shigella vaccine, which is based on a rough Shigella strain lacking LPS O-antigen which is non-invasive through a mutation of the invasion plasmid, specifically for use in the immunoprophylaxis of a subject to prevent infectious diseases, preferably enteral disease, and a Shigella strain, which is a S. flexneri 2a strain with a deletion of the rfb F, ipa B and/or ipa C genes, as well as a recombinant plasmid vector based on a mutated Shigella invasion plasmid comprising a nucleotide sequence encoding at least one heterologous antigen, wherein the plasmid is mutated in at least one of the ipa B and/or ipa C genes.

  • Patent number: 9508185
    Abstract: Methods, systems, and devices for rendering computer graphics using texture maps are disclosed. Multiple texture maps with disparate data types, such as a mix of integer data types for RGB colors and floating point data types for XYZ normal vector components, are passed as one texture map set to a graphics processing unit (GPU). Filter parameters and other interpolation parameters are re-used between the disparate texture maps. A user can specify a number of integer and floating point-based channels for processing at one time by the GPU, thereby customizing a texture set structure.

  • Publication number: 20140224406
    Abstract: The present invention relates to polyisocyanate-based impregnating resin system, which is a liquid polyisocyanate mixture, containing more than 50% by weight MDI based di- and polyisocyanates, and one or more, originally powdery inorganic hydroxides. The resin system of the invention is suitable for the preparation of prepregs. The invention relates also to the prepreg that can be manufactured with the use of the resin system, and use thereof. Among the uses of the invention one important is the use of the prepreg for lining chimneys.
